South Fayette Township, Pennsylvania Number and Rate of Violent Crimes By Crime Type in 2012

Updated on January 14, 2025.

According to the FBI UCR data, in 2012, there were 3 violent crimes in the city of South Fayette Township, PA; and the violent crime rate per 100K residents was 20.73. Violent crimes are crimes which involve force or threat of force. The specific number and type of Violent Crimes included: Robbery (2), Aggravated Assault (1), and Murder and Non-Negligent Manslaughter (0).
